- For the logs, you can use Loki: How to easily configure Grafana Loki and Promtail to receive logs from Heroku | Grafana Labs
- And for the metrics, you will need to expose them from your app (e.g.
myapp.com/metrics
) and scrap them yourself.
Note: for both of those you will need an extra instance (Promtail to get the logs out and Prometheus Agent to scrap the metrics). I believe Grafana Agent can do both at the same time.
By an extra instance, I mean a Docker Container running somewhere to take the metrics and logs from your Heroku and pass them to Grafana Cloud. They don’t need a database, it’s all handled by Grafana Cloud.
I’m still figuring this out so this may not be the best alternative, but I have made it work for myself.
